Thread forming screws for plastics with a Torx drive deliver secure, high-torque joints without pre-tapping. For enclosures, electronics housings, and automotive interiors, these fasteners form clean, strong threads in plastics such as ABS, PC, and reinforced polymers, reducing assembly steps and minimizing thread stripping. Key choices include Torx size, thread form, head style, and coating, which affect seating, vibration resistance, and cosmetic finish.
